"the prevention of gender violence between partners (partner violence) requires that it be addressed before violence erupts."
 
 
Is this sentence correct? Suggestions?

It is probably ok the way you said it, but my initial reaction was that I would say requires "addressing" it before violence errupts. (using a gerund after the verb "requires")
 
A search brought up this similar  sentence using "reaching" instead of "reach":

"Preventing intimate partner violence requires reaching a clear understanding of those factors, coordinating resources, and fostering and initiating change in individuals, families, and society."
